Job Title:

HCM Payroll Leadership Role

Job Description:

We are seeking a seasoned payroll professional to lead our HCM payroll team.

This role is pivotal in establishing and growing our offshore capability, working closely with our UK-based counterparts to deliver high-quality managed services to clients.

You will oversee a team of payroll-focused support consultants, manage performance and development, and play a hands-on role in delivering support across Oracle Cloud Payroll and HCM solutions.

Main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age a team of Payroll and HCM support consultants based in India, including recruitment, onboarding, mentoring, and line management responsibilities
  • Work closely with the UK Payroll Support Lead to build a cohesive, cross-regional support function and align on service processes and client priorities
  • Act as the subject matter expert on Oracle Cloud Payroll, providing deep expertise in configuration, processing, troubleshooting, and legislative compliance
  • Supervise and contribute to quarterly Oracle Cloud release cycles, including impact analysis, regression testing, deployment, and communication of relevant changes to clients
  • Deliver and coordinate training and knowledge-sharing sessions for team members to support capability growth and process alignment
  • Troubleshoot and replicate functional issues, escalating to Oracle as needed and maintaining clear, well-documented resolutions
  • Build and maintain strong client relationships, ensuring a high level of satisfaction through responsive, proactive support and communication
  • Drive improvements in support processes, documentation, and internal tooling, helping to establish a scalable, high-performing payroll support model
  • Review and recommend enhancements from Oracle Cloud updates that would deliver value to clients
  • Actively contribute to internal knowledge bases and support materials, and champion a culture of continuous improvement
  • Provide strategic input into the ongoing development and structure of the India Managed Services team
  • Act as a key liaison between India and UK teams, ensuring seamless collaboration and shared ownership of outcomes
